New York Layoffs — November 2010
Employers in New York logged 16 WARN Act notices in November 2010, involving roughly 1,055 workers — falling below October and down 80% versus November 2009. The average filing covered 66 workers, with 7 closures among the notices.

Largest Layoffs
| Company | City | Workers | Type | Date |
|---|---|---|---|---|
| Sitel Operating Corporation - Corning Call Center | Painted Post | 304 | Layoff | |
| NBA Store | New York | 175 | Closure | |
| Partsearch Technologies | Kingston | 140 | Layoff | |
| Kosher Valley | Plainville | 98 | Closure | |
| Kellogg Capital Markets, LLC (KCM) | New York | 72 | Layoff | |
| Lime Wire | New York | 59 | Closure | |
| Nathan Miller Center for Nursing Care | White Plains | 58 | Closure | |
| Partsearch Technologies | New York | 46 | Layoff | |
| Kellogg Partners Institutional Services | New York | 29 | Closure | |
| Pfizer Inc. (formerly Wyeth Pharmaceuticals) | Pearl River | 28 | Layoff | |
| Cablevision Systems Corporation Holdings, LLC (Service Recovery Compliance Unit) | Riverhead | 26 | Closure | |
| MT Transportation Logistics Services | Bethpage | 6 | Layoff | |
| New Process Gear, Inc. (Division of Magna Powertrain) | East Syracuse | 6 | Closure | |
| St Vincent's Services | Brooklyn | 5 | Layoff | |
| Eastman Kodak Company (Eastman Park) | Rochester | 2 | Layoff |
The biggest impact was at Sitel Operating Corporation - Corning Call Center at its Painted Post facility, reporting 304 affected workers. NBA Store followed with 175 workers.

The Worker Adjustment and Retraining Notification (WARN) Act requires employers with 100+ employees to provide 60-day advance notice of mass layoffs and plant closings.
